Anwar congratulates Modi on becoming India's longest-serving elected PM
Modi has been serving as Prime Minister since May 2014. - June 10, 2026

PRIME Minister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im has congratulated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i on his historic milestone of becoming the country’s longest-serving elected prime minister.

In a Facebook post today, Anwar said the achievement reflects Modi’s years of dedicated public service and leadership in advancing India’s development, prosperity and standing on the global stage.

“Heartiest congratulations to PM Modi on this historic milestone of becoming India’s longest-serving elected prime minister," he said, reported Bernama.

Modi has been serving as Prime Minister since May 2014.

Anwar said Malaysia values its close and longstanding friendship with India and looks forward to continuing cooperation to strengthen bilateral ties and expand opportunities for the peoples of both countries.

“I wish PM Modi continued success and the people of India continued peace, progress and prosperity,” he said. – June 10, 2026
